#136f51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#136f51 is composed of 7.5% red, 43.5%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 27%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 160.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 25.5%. #136f51 color hex could be obtained by blending #26dea2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

● #136f51 color description : Very dark cyan - lime green.
#136f51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#136f51 has RGB values of R:19, G:111,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 1273681.
